
This episode of the Waveform podcast features tech YouTuber Michael Fisher, also known as Mr. Mobile, interviewing co-host Marquez Brownlee. Key topics include the art of product reviews, the evolving role of YouTube in tech, and the impact of AI on creators.
Fisher and Brownlee discuss the differences between reviews and ads, with Fisher sharing his thoughts on the challenges of staying relevant to younger audiences. They also touch on the current state of smartphones, including foldables and the importance of storytelling in tech reviews.
The conversation shifts to the ethics of reviewing products, with Fisher expressing that he does not feel guilty about potentially harming a company's success with a negative review, as poor products are the real issue. They also explore the pressures of sponsored content and how audience expectations have evolved.
Fisher shares insights into his work as a co-founder of Clicks Technology and the challenges of balancing product creation with content creation. The episode concludes with a light-hearted lightning round, where they discuss favorite failures in mobile tech and memorable moments of being recognized in public.
